[OBJECTIVES] The purpose of this study was to investigate the changes in the concentration of blood angiogenic factors and pro-inflammatory cytokines during acute exercise after the administration of branched-chain amino acid (BCAA) and glutamine. [METHODS] All 7 adolescent male athletes performed 2000 m rowing exercise after the completion of each of three different 7-day treatments; non-treatment (CO); a total daily dose of BCAA 3.15 g (1.05g×3) (BCAA); or both a total daily dose of BCAA 3.15 g (1.05 g × 3) and glutamine 6 g (2 g × 3) (BC+GLU). There was a 30-day rest period between each treatment. After intake of amino acids for 7 days, the participants completed the rowing exercise on day 8, and their blood samples were collected (at resting state, Rest; immediately after exercise, Ex0; and 30 min after the exercise, Ex30) and were analyzed using ELISA. [RESULTS] The concentration of Vascular endothelial growth factor (VEGF) increased in the BCAA and BC+GLU treatment groups compared to that at Rest in the CO group (p<0.05). Interleukin-6 (IL-6) increased at Ex0 compared to that at Rest in the CO and BCAA treatment groups (p<0.05), and significantly decreased at Ex30 compared to that at Ex0 in the BCAA treatment group (p<0.05). However, significant differences were not observed in BC+GLU at Ex0 and Ex30 compared to at Rest. IL-8 also significantly increased at Ex0 compared to at Rest, and significantly decreased at Ex30 compared to at Ex0 in CO (p<0.05). However, the blood IL-8 level in BCAA and BC+GLU were not altered by acute exercise. [CONCLUSIONS] This study suggested that the administrations of BCAA and/or glutamine have enough to induce increase of VEGF concentration and inhibited the increase of pro-inflammatory cytokines after acute exercise in adolescence athletes.

Background/Aims: We compared the cirrhosis-prediction accuracy of an ultrasonographic scoring system (USSS) combining six representative sonographic indices with that of liver stiffness measurement (LSM) by transient elastography, and prospectively investigated the correlation between the USSS score and LSM in predicting cirrhosis. Methods: Two hundred and thirty patients with chronic liver diseases (187 men, 43 women; age, 50.4±9.5 y, mean±SD) were enrolled in this prospective study. The USSS produces a combined score for nodularity of the liver surface and edge, parenchyma echogenicity, presence of right-lobe atrophy, spleen size, splenic vein diameter, and abnormality of the hepatic vein waveform. The correlations of the USSS score and LSM with that of a pathological liver biopsy (METAVIR scoring system: F0.F4) were evaluated. Results: The mean USSS score and LSM were 7.2 and 38.0 kPa, respectively, in patients with histologically overt cirrhosis (F4, P=0.017) and 4.3 and 22.1 kPa in patients with fibrotic change without overt cirrhosis (F0.F3) (P=0.025). The areas under the receiver operating characteristic (ROC) curves of the USSS score and LSM for F4 patients were 0.849 and 0.729, respectively. On the basis of ROC curves, criteria of USSS ≥6: LSM ≥17.4 had a sensitivity, specificity, positive predictive value, negative predictive value, and accuracy of 89.2%:77.6%, 69.4%:61.4%, 86.5%:83.7%, 74.6%:51.9% and 0.83:0.73, respectively, in predicting F4. Conclusions: The results indicate that this USSS has comparable effi cacy to LSM in the diagnosis of cirrhosis.

In addition to increasing atmospheric COz, ecosystems experience various levels of COz. For example, levels of COz must be heterogeneous in soil matrices as expected from spatial variation of denitrification rates (Parkin 1987). The patchy distribution of particulate organic matter may lead to highly variable levels of COz through microbial consumption of Oz in soil air, when isolation of air pocket due to poor aeration in soil pores impedes diffusive transport of gases. The isolation may occur at micropores inside soil aggregates and at macropores between aggregates. In particular, many confined air pockets may be distributed in poorly drained soils and even in general soils during and just after a period of rainfall. GO-14 : Paratubal Serous Bordeline Tumor: a Case Report

Paratubal serous borderline tumors are identified mild epithelial atypia and proliferation without stromal invasion. Fallopian tubal or paratubal borderline tumors are extremely rare. Therefore, the clinic and pathologic characteristics and treatments of these tumors are unclear. A 43 year-old married female with obstetric history of 3-0-2-3 (T-P-A-L) complained of pain in lower abdomen. Abdominal CT and MRI revealed corpus luteum in ovary. And HPV 18 test which is in high risk group was positive. After left pelviscopic paratubal cystectomy, pathologic result revealed the left salpinx as serous borderline tumor. Following up with paratubal serous borderline tumors are important because it is essential to decide the treatment and predict the prognosis of this tumor. The evaluation of the structure of cyst by ultrasonography and the performance of intraoperative frozen section analysis are important. Since most of these tumors are unilateral and confined to the fallopian tube or paratubal cyst and most patients are young, fertility-sparing surgery with comprehensive surgical staging procedures is acceptable, and adjuvant chemotherapy is likely unnecessary. Acceptable fertility-sparing procedures for young patients who desire to maintain childbearing include salpingectomy for fallopian tubal serous borderline tumors and paratubal cystectomy for paratubal serous borderline tumors.
